Health Tip: Enjoy Screen-Free Fun With Your Preschooler
By LadyLively on May 20, 2016
Your preschooler needs lots of creative time for healthy growth and development — including limited screen time.
The American Academy of Pediatrics recommends:
- Play classic kids games such as the limbo, “London bridges falling down,” and “duck, duck, goose.”
- Have an (hardboiled) egg and spoon race.
- Play “Simon says” and “head, shoulders, knees and toes.”
- Head out for a nature walk.
- Start a game of “follow the leader.”
- Play a game of “tag.”
